Hi everyone! I'm a new member. After hours of research I've come here for your expertise.

I'm the owner of an 08 Megane II Convertible. 40k on the clock and frequently serviced, recently passed it's MOT.

However, the problem I'm having is a constant humming sound (sounds like it's coming from O/S rear) which get's louder and of and higher pitch when speed increases. This sound remains when clutch is held down and when the car is in neutral. The sound goes, at least and little bit, with a turn to the right. I've noticed it 'goes off' with a 45 degree turn to the right, or more.

Wheel bearing seems like it may be the culprit but I can't help but feel that the non-matching rear tyres may be the issue, although tread and wear appears fine. Also, there's nothing odd when throwing a trusty bucket of water at each wheel after a good run.

So, members of wisdom, what are your thoughts? ...and thank you in advance.
